Spending my left-over Christmas money is proving difficult. I've already splashed out on a PC that is both cheaper and faster than an Xbox 360, and built the most obscene multi-monitor set-up outside of an aircraft simulator, but I've still got £1,154 burning a hole in my virtual pocket.

Trawling the Internet for inspiration, I stumbled across the Followit Personal Tracking Bundle (£640) -- a GPS tracking system you can use to keep tabs on just about anything.

I can come up with an almost infinite number of uses for this thing -- like sewing it into the lining of your child's jacket to find out whether they're actually turning up at school. Better still, you could secrete it amongst the lip-gloss, makeup and other miscellaneous junk in your girlfriend's purse to see if she really is going to the hairdressers and not nipping off on a sordid weekend with some rich banker she met while highly inebriated at the office Christmas party. The floozy.

The best part is, you don't have to chase your subject in a Land Rover and shoot them with a tranquilliser dart. Unless you really want to.

But I digress. The Personal Tracking Bundle must be used with a GSM SIM card, so I've opted for the O2 pre-pay card (£4.98) from www.ebuyer.com. Once up and running, all you have to do is text '601, status' to the mobile number of the SIM card and the tracking devive will respond via text with its exact latitude and longitude, to within a few metres. To get the most out of the setup, I've also decided to buy the Followit Locator PC software for £75.

Okay, so Christmas isn't supposed to be a time for paranoia and distrust, but I'm sure you'll agree there are worse ways to spend £720. -Rory Reid
